Brief summary

This is an open-label, single center, pilot study to assess the feasibility of baseline 89Zr-trastuzumab PET/CT to predict response to treatment with monotherapy MT-5111

Interventions

-To minimize uptake of the 89Zr-trastuzumab in normal tissues, immediately prior to planned 89Zr-trastuzumab injection patients will receive a 50 mg dose of cold unlabeled trastuzumab intravenously (IV). The administration of a fixed small dose of unlabeled antibody to improve tumor-to-normal-tissue (T/N) uptake of the radiolabeled antibody is standard in this type of imaging procedure.
